The cheapest way to get from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ln is to bus which costs £26 - £70 and takes 5h 35m.
The fastest way to get from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ln is to drive which takes 2h 14m and costs £28 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ln station. However, there are services departing from Abbey and arriving at Rail Station Car Park via Luton Station Interchange and Milton Keynes Coachway.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 35m.
No, there is no direct train from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ln. However, there are services departing from St Albans City and arriving at Lincoln Central via King's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 23m.
The distance between St Albans Cathedral and Lincoln is 158 miles. The road distance is 118.3 miles.
The best way to get from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ln without a car is to train which takes 3h 23m and costs £55 - £85.
It takes approximately 3h 23m to get from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ln, including transfers.
St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Milton Keynes Coachway station.
St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ln train services, operated by London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ER), depart from King's Cross station.
The best way to get from St Albans Cathedral to Lincoln is to train which takes 3h 23m and costs £55 - £85.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£26 - £70 and takes 5h 35m.
